      They're 3 types of Traffic, traffic you create, traffic you buy, and traffic
      you borrow. First, google your keywords and take a look at the top 10
      websites. Take some time to check them out and see how your content
      could fit their audience. Then, check to see if they offer advertising on
      their website.

      If they don't, contact them via email and ask them if they would be
      interesting in offering advertising or giving away your content to their
      subscribers. If you do this for your most important keywords and land
      couple websites, it's already targeted traffic, and since you know your
      conversion you can decide on how much you spend or how much sites
      your going to do this with. This old school method still work
